The latest incarnation of the original Boomerang launched in 1995 is the Boomerang III Phrase Sampler, which sports a tonne of new features, including the hosting of up to four independent loops, different play modes, half speed/one octave down, reverse, fade and many other functions. The sound quality is fantastic at 48Khz/20 bit, so the pedal won't affect your tone in the slightest, and having multiple loops at the same time enables the user to erase and re-record loops while other loops are playing. In addition, having a master loop enables you set up a percussive beat to quantize to so all your loops stay perfectly in time. Add the ability to sync loops together, have them run in free-form (for ambient soundscapes), and to drop the pitch and speed down an octave for bass lines, and you have an extremely versatile tool, for composition, live performance and improvisation.
